4165 Lippincott Blvd, Burton, MI 48519-1819
This exceptional Burton, MI industrial property presents a unique investment opportunity. The 8.7-acre site encompasses a substantial 7,452 square foot mixed-use building, ideal for a variety of businesses. A significant portion of the building is dedicated to a 5,400 square foot heated warehouse, boasting 16-foot ceilings, insulated block walls for superior climate control, and a convenient overhead door for easy loading and unloading. The warehouse space is complemented by five well-appointed offices, complete with a functional kitchen area, providing comfortable and efficient workspace. Adding to the versatility, a medical tenant currently occupies a separately metered section of the building, accessing the property via its own dedicated entrance. The property enjoys excellent visibility and convenient access to major interstate highways, ensuring high traffic flow and easy transportation. This strategic location makes it exceptionally attractive for a wide range of commercial uses. Further enhancing its potential, a contiguous 7.5-acre commercial lot is available for purchase, presenting significant expansion or development opportunities. This combined acreage offers substantial room for growth and future development, making this a truly remarkable investment prospect in a thriving commercial area. The asking price for this exceptional property is $550,000.
